CB is an extension of the Joomla user profile and is therefore dependent on Joomla to run. I doubt there is fork from Joomla in the future for CB. The only Joomla plugins or third-party integrations that might have conflicts with CB are those that alter the Joomla users table in some way or require their own login module.
